Mercedes MBE 4000 Engine Overview

The Mercedes MBE 4000 engine has been a significant player in the heavy-duty diesel engine market since its introduction in the late 1990s. Designed primarily for commercial vehicles, this engine was engineered to provide a balance of power, efficiency, and reliability. It quickly gained traction among fleet operators and truck manufacturers, becoming a popular choice for various applications, including long-haul trucking and construction. The MBE 4000 is known for its robust construction and advanced technology, which includes features such as a high-pressure common rail fuel injection system and a turbocharged design aimed at maximizing performance while minimizing emissions.

Common Issues with the Mercedes MBE 4000 Engine

The Mercedes MBE 4000 engine, while known for its power and efficiency, has been plagued by a series of problems that can significantly impact its performance and reliability. Understanding these issues is essential for fleet operators and mechanics alike, as they can lead to costly repairs and downtime. Below are some of the most frequently reported problems associated with this engine.

1. Fuel System Failures

One of the most common issues with the MBE 4000 is related to its fuel system. Problems can arise due to:

  • Injector Failures: The fuel injectors can become clogged or fail, leading to poor engine performance and increased emissions.
  • Fuel Pump Issues: The fuel pump may experience wear and tear, resulting in inconsistent fuel delivery and potential engine stalling.
  • Contaminated Fuel: Using low-quality or contaminated fuel can lead to significant damage to the fuel system components.

2. Cooling System Problems

Overheating is another critical issue that can affect the MBE 4000 engine. Common causes include:

  • Radiator Failures: A malfunctioning radiator can lead to inadequate cooling, causing the engine to overheat.
  • Water Pump Issues: A failing water pump can disrupt coolant circulation, further exacerbating overheating problems.
  • Coolant Leaks: Leaks in the cooling system can lead to low coolant levels, resulting in overheating and potential engine damage.

3. Electrical System Malfunctions

The electrical system of the MBE 4000 can also present challenges, including:

  • Sensor Failures: Various sensors, such as the crankshaft position sensor, can fail, leading to erratic engine behavior.
  • Wiring Issues: Corroded or damaged wiring can cause electrical shorts, impacting engine performance and reliability.

4. Exhaust System Complications

Issues with the exhaust system can lead to increased emissions and reduced engine efficiency. Common problems include:

  • EGR Valve Failures: The Exhaust Gas Recirculation (EGR) valve can become clogged or fail, leading to increased nitrogen oxide emissions.
  • DPF Blockages: Diesel Particulate Filters (DPF) can become blocked, requiring costly cleaning or replacement.

Symptoms and Consequences

Recognizing the symptoms of these problems early can prevent further damage and costly repairs. Below is a table summarizing common symptoms and their potential consequences:

Symptom Potential Consequence
Poor engine performance Increased fuel consumption, potential engine failure
Overheating Severe engine damage, costly repairs
Check engine light Underlying issues requiring immediate attention
Excessive smoke from exhaust Increased emissions, potential fines for non-compliance
Unusual noises from the engine Possible mechanical failure, requiring immediate inspection
